About Kunti Bhannar

Kunti Bhannar is a mapped peak in the Uttarakhand Himalaya, at an elevation of about 5,895 metres, in Chamoli district. The nearest mapped village is Malari, about 3 km away. Location data © OpenStreetMap contributors - verify conditions and access locally before travelling.

Best time to visit
May-June and September-October; snowbound and largely inaccessible in winter, and risky during the monsoon.

Seasons and access are general guidance for the Uttarakhand Himalaya - high-altitude conditions change fast, so verify locally before you travel.
